¿Cuáles son los lenguajes de programación más populares y los más buscados por las empresas? Como vemos, la demanda de ingenieros de software lleva tiempo aumentando. Las predicciones muestran que esta tendencia al alza continuará.
Según un estudio realizado por BLS, se espera que los puestos de programación aumenten un 21% de aquí a 2028. Además, también crece el número de personas interesadas en ampliar sus conocimientos sobre estas herramientas.
Este post presenta los lenguajes de programación más populares. Veamos qué tecnologías serán las más populares en 2023.
Es un lenguaje de programación orientado a objetos, flexible y de propósito general creado hace 30 años por Guido van Rossum. Esta tecnología se utiliza en el desarrollo de aplicaciones como: Instagram, Pinterest, Disqus, Uber, Reddit, Dropbox, Spotify, Google Search, Youtube y muchas más. Su versatilidad, desde el scripting, la ejecución de servidores o el análisis de datos, ha sido clave para lograr este hito. Además, Python cuenta con una de las mayores y más grandes comunidades que existen.
JavaScript es el rey del Frontend. Es un lenguaje de programación que se utiliza para hacer funcionar los sitios web. Según una encuesta realizada por Stack Overflow, es el lenguaje de programación más popular y el segundo más demandado en 2022. Aunque es el lenguaje más popular, también fue la tecnología más demandada por las empresas en los años 2020 y 2021.
Al igual que Python, tiene una comunidad fuerte y muchas bibliotecas y frameworks que facilitan el trabajo con el lenguaje. JavaScript no tiene competencia si necesitas crear un Frontend para tu sitio web, aplicación o software. Es una de las mejores plataformas en caso de construir elementos dinámicos en el sitio web.
Si estás listo para aprender JavaScript, no busques más, Academia Web cuenta con un curso de JavaScript. Este curso dirigido por un instructor te guiará a través del lenguaje JavaScript para que aprendas todos sus fundamentos.
El lenguaje Java ha sido realmente popular desde su creación en 1995. Aunque esta popularidad ha ido disminuyendo en los últimos años con la aparición de lenguajes más modernos como Kotlin, sigue ocupando un sólido puesto en el top. Además, Java sigue siendo un lenguaje estable que apoyan muchas grandes empresas. Lo utilizan empresas como la NASA, Netflix, Spotify, LinkedIn, Uber, Amazon y muchas más.
Este lenguaje de programación se utiliza ahora en aplicaciones móviles, desarrollo web e incluso Big Data. Es el principal lenguaje de programación para dispositivos Android, por lo que su demanda seguirá siendo alta. Hoy en día sigue siendo la 5ta tecnología más popular según Stack Overflow.
C# Es un lenguaje de programación de propósito general, multiparadigma y orientado a objetos. Creado principalmente para subsanar algunos de los puntos débiles de C + +. Como lenguaje de propósito general, C# tiene una amplia gama de casos de uso.
El uso más común de C# es con el framework .NET. También se utiliza mucho en el framework de juegos Unity para la creación de scripts. Tanto el marco .NET como Unity son populares entre las empresas de primer nivel.
Puedes utilizar esta tecnología para crear aplicaciones para Windows, videojuegos, software anti-hacking, aplicaciones para móviles, RV y muchas más. Lo utilizan gigantes mundiales como Slack y Pinterest.
Esta tecnología fue desarrollada por Google en 2007 y se utiliza para desarrollar aplicaciones web y API. A pesar de que Go no ha recibido una tasa de crecimiento a tal escala como los lenguajes descritos anteriormente, todavía puede clasificarse como muy buscado en las habilidades.
Es un lenguaje de programación de propósito general, fácil de aprender y con una sintaxis limpia, lo que facilita la escritura de software sencillo, fiable y eficiente.
Hoy en día es una de las tecnologías mejor pagadas y el segundo lenguaje de programación backend más demandado. Eso significa que, si aprendes este lenguaje de programación, no tendrás problemas para encontrar un trabajo bien remunerado. Según Stack Overflow, la mediana de su salario anual ronda los 76.000 dólares.
Go, al igual que Python, se utiliza para crear sistemas basados en inteligencia artificial, por lo que es probable que su popularidad siga creciendo.
Han pasado 50 años desde la primera versión de C, y 37 desde la posterior aparición de C + +. De este lenguaje derivan otros lenguajes como JavaScript y C#. Ambos lenguajes tienen un alto rendimiento, por lo que se utilizan habitualmente para crear diferentes aplicaciones.
Son lenguajes universales, lo que significa que pueden compilarse para muchos sistemas. A los programadores les encanta ser muy rápidos y eficientes.
El C++ moderno incluye características orientadas a objetos, genéricas y también funcionales. También facilita la manipulación de memoria a bajo nivel. Su uso en la industria está muy extendido, C + + puede encontrarse en videojuegos, servidores, bases de datos, sondas espaciales y muchos otros.
Ruby es un lenguaje de programación interpretado y totalmente orientado a objetos. Se desarrolló en los años 90 y suele considerarse fácil de aprender. Al tratarse de una tecnología con una sintaxis sencilla, suele utilizarse para la creación de scripts, el procesamiento de textos y la creación de prototipos de nuevas aplicaciones.
Su gran ventaja son los enormes frameworks y aplicaciones web escritas en este lenguaje, como el conocido Ruby on Rails.
Ruby es un lenguaje estable y popular utilizado por Twitch, Twitter, Shopify, Starbucks o Tumblr. Además, es el sexto lenguaje de programación mejor pagado del mundo.
El lenguaje que hace veintisiete años comenzó como una simple "Personal Home Page Tool", aquí el nombre PHP, ha hecho un viaje increíble desde entonces. Es así, que PHP es el quinto lenguaje de programación más demandado en 2022.
Terminando el 2022 con un 10% de la demanda de todas las ofertas de trabajo de desarrollo, lo que significa que 1 de cada 10 trabajos de desarrollo requieren PHP.
PHP se utiliza principalmente para el desarrollo web, junto con frameworks como Laravel o WordPress.
SQL es un lenguaje que permite a los programadores consultar y manipular bases de datos. Como lenguaje específico de un dominio, está diseñado principalmente para gestionar datos dentro de un RDBMS (sistema de gestión de bases de datos relacionales).
En pocas palabras, SQL puede localizar y recuperar datos de una base de datos, así como actualizar, añadir o eliminar registros.
Aunque SQL es muy funcional, tiende a funcionar mejor con bases de datos pequeñas y no siempre se presta a gestionar bases de datos extensas.
Dicho esto, SQL sigue siendo uno de los lenguajes más utilizados en la industria de la programación, con más de la mitad (54,7%) de los desarrolladores encuestados que afirman utilizarlo.
© All Rights Reserved.